Quality Assurance: Beyond the Material Certificate In mass transfer, a 1% deviation in geometry can lead to a 10% drop in tower efficiency. When sourcing from India, your QA checklist must include: Material Verification (PMI Testing): Ensure your supplier performs Positive Material Identification. At Aera, we provide full traceability for SS304L, SS316L, and exotic alloys like Titanium or Hastelloy to ensure they withstand the corrosive environments of 2026 chemical processing. Dimensional Precision: Random packing relies on 'void fraction.' Requesting a Statistical Process Control (SPC) report ensures that the aspect ratio of your CMR Rings or the 'fingers' of your Pall Rings are consistent across a multi-ton order. Third-Party Inspection (TPI): For mission-critical turnarounds, Aera facilitates inspections by global bodies like SGS, TUV, or Bureau Veritas right at our Vadodara facility before the goods are crated. 2. Export-Grade Packaging: Tower packings are susceptible to deformation if crushed. We utilize reinforced, stackable sea-worthy crates and moisture-barrier lining to ensure that your IMTP Saddles arrive with their aerodynamic integrity intact. 3. Procurement Checklist for 2026 Sourcing Before signing your next Purchase Order, verify these four points with your Indian partner: Does the supplier use automated manufacturing? (Reduces human error in ring formation). Is the packaging optimized for volume? (Reduces ocean freight costs). Are they compliant with the latest ISO 9001:2025 standards? Can they provide 'Speed-to-Site' for emergency turnarounds?
